What about something you make yourself?
Can you sew/embroider? I've made racquet covers, monogrammed towels and shirts, book covers, eyeglass cases, etc as gifts and they are very much appreciated.
Can you paint? A picture? Buy a wooden box and paint it....
Do you like craft work? make a candle holder.. a box from wood, papier maiché, cloth and cardboard,
There are lots of good books aroung on making things.
It is something that no-one else can duplicate.
A book is usually a good gift in almost every circumstance, choose it according to individual taste and write a dedication according to the circumstance.
